Director Of Field Operations RenewablesThe company is a recognized leader in delivering complex infrastructure solutions across renewables, pipelines, and utility markets. They combine decades of construction excellence with a forward-looking approach to energy and utility development.
With a strong reputation for safety, quality, and operational performance, the company is experiencing continued growth across multiple markets and is investing in leadership that can scale operations, strengthen customer partnerships, and drive long-term value.
The Director of Field Operations Renewables is a critical executive leadership role responsible for the safe, profitable, and high-quality execution of all field operations across assigned markets and projects.
Reporting to the Vice President & General Manager, this leader will oversee General Superintendents, Superintendents, and field teams while driving operational excellence across safety, workforce planning, production, financial performance, and compliance.
This role is ideal for a seasoned construction executive who thrives in complex, multi-state environments and is passionate about building scalable systems, developing high-performing teams, and delivering best-in-class project outcomes. The position will be based in either Sacramento or San Diego.
Key ResponsibilitiesProvide strategic oversight of construction and field operations across renewables, utilities, and pipeline projects
Ensure all projects are delivered in alignment with design, specifications, budget, and schedule
Lead workforce planning, forecasting, and compliance across union and multi-state environments
Drive a zero-incident safety culture in partnership with safety leadership
Optimize equipment utilization, capital planning, and supply chain logistics
Develop and mentor field leadership, building a strong succession pipeline
Strengthen relationships with clients, agencies, contractors, and industry partners
Collaborate cross-functionally to align operational priorities with business growth objectives
Champion continuous improvement, process optimization, and change management initiatives
RequirementsEducation & ExperienceBachelor's degree in Engineering, Construction Management, or related field (or equivalent experience)
10+ years of progressive experience in construction, utilities, or energy sectors
10+ years in senior leadership roles with strategic oversight responsibilities
Proven experience scaling operations across multiple regions or states
Core CompetenciesExecutive presence with strong influence and leadership credibility
Deep expertise in union environments and workforce management
Strong knowledge of utility, renewable energy, and regulatory frameworks
Ability to manage multiple complex projects simultaneously
Experience with process improvement and organizational change initiatives
High-level financial and operational acumen
BenefitsBase Salary:$225,000 $290,000 (commensurate with experience and location)
Comprehensive benefits package including health, retirement, and paid time off
Executive-level visibility and impact within a growing organization
Opportunity to shape operational strategy across a rapidly expanding renewables portfolio
Leadership role within a company committed to safety, innovation, and long-term growth
